Things to look out for mainly are rusty arches, not usually a problem on the imports as most will have been undersealed but pretty common in EK4's nowdays, any smoking in vtec isn't usually a good sign; and distasteful mods seem to be a problem, avoid ones with 17 inch ripspeed alloys and angel eyes.
